Nina Reeves has become the WSB’s leading suspect in Jack Brennan’s disappearance, and on General Hospital, the woman sitting across from her at lunch already knows exactly what happened to him.


A Threat Nobody Forgot

When William Baines started digging into Jack’s disappearance, Carly handed him a name without hesitating: Nina Reeves. Baines had already implied Carly herself was involved and accused Valentin of killing Jack over the old Pikeman deal that once sent him to Steinmauer, so Carly redirected him fast. She told Baines all about the argument she’d witnessed between Jack and Nina, including Nina’s threat to “destroy” Jack if he didn’t come through with something Willow needed. Valentin jumped to Carly’s defense the moment Baines tried to pin Jack’s disappearance on her, but he couldn’t do the same for Nina.

Valentin admitted he partly blames himself for Nina’s involvement with Jack in the first place, since the Pikeman fallout is what tied the two of them together to begin with, and he knows exactly what that involvement looks like from the outside. If anything actually happened to Jack, Valentin said flatly, Nina would be the prime suspect. Nobody in that conversation seemed to notice that the same argument being used against Nina is the argument that should be pointing everyone toward the truth instead.

The Woman Who Already Knows

While Baines builds his case, Nina is sitting at the Metro Court Gardens catching up with Ava, who is running the exact same tick-bite cover story on her that she used on Dr. Gannon. Nina Reeves has no idea she’s confiding in the one person who actually knows Jack is dead, and she has even less idea that a WSB agent is watching the two of them from across the room. She told Ava she hasn’t heard from Jack since they fought over Willow, and admitted she genuinely liked him and wished they’d both handled things differently before things went quiet between them.

Ava couldn’t tell Nina the truth without exposing herself, so she settled for telling Nina that the distance was for the best. Across the restaurant, Baines watched the two women with his focus locked entirely on Nina, quietly building a case against a woman whose biggest crime so far is trusting the wrong lunch date.

Two People Already Know, And Neither Is Nina

Ava isn’t even the only one sitting on this secret. Drew also already knows Jack is dead, and instead of grieving anyone, he’s using that knowledge to threaten Willow and dig for evidence Jack supposedly had against him. That means two separate people are walking around Port Charles fully aware of what happened to Jack, on General Hospital, while a WSB agent builds a case against the one woman who genuinely doesn’t know anything at all.

Nina Reeves is currently the only major player in this triangle without the actual facts, which makes her the easiest person to frame, accidentally or otherwise. Baines doesn’t need Nina to be guilty. He needs her history with Jack to look bad enough that nobody bothers asking who else in Port Charles had a reason to want Jack gone for good.
